A sweet and savory slow cooker sesame chicken made with apricot jam, soy sauce, and ginger. Serve over rice with scallions and sesame seeds.

Let's Prepare

Collect

Gather these ingredients - no prep needed yet.

  • 118 ml apricot jam
  • 59.1 ml ketchup
  • 29.6 ml reduced-sodium soy sauce
  • 1.23 ml red pepper flakes
  • cooked long-grain white rice
  • scallions
  • sesame seeds

Prepare

  • 14.8 ml fresh ginger, grated peeled
  • Trim 907 g boneless, skinless chicken thighs
  • Chop 1 medium onion
  • 2 garlic cloves, finely chopped
  • 1 red bell pepper, sliced into ¼-inch pieces

Let's Cook

  1. Step 1.

    In a 5- to 6-quart slow cooker, combine the apricot jam, ketchup, soy sauce, grated ginger, and red pepper flakes. Add the chicken thighs, chopped onion, and finely chopped garlic; toss everything together to coat evenly.

  2. Step 2.

    Scatter the sliced red bell pepper over the top of the chicken mixture. Cover the slow cooker and cook until the chicken is cooked through and tender, 5 to 6 hours on low or 3 to 4 hours on high.

  3. Step 3.

    Serve the chicken and sauce over cooked long-grain white rice. Sprinkle with sliced scallions and sesame seeds if desired.
